How to Maintain Air conditioning units in coastal areas face unique challenges that can significantly affect their performance and lifespan. The salty sea air, high humidity, and frequent exposure to sand and debris create an environment where AC systems are prone to corrosion, wear, and malfunction. If you notice warm air coming from your air conditioning vents, it's a sign that something is wrong with your system. This could be due to a variety of issues, including a faulty compressor or a refrigerant leak. It's important to have a professional HVAC technician diagnose the issue and make any necessary repairs| Ross and Witmer
